Choosing the right wall substrate before tiling

The detail that matters

Point 1

Old plaster rarely takes heavy large-format tile; overboarding with cement or foam backer gives a known, rated surface.

Point 2

Any deflection in a stud wall shows up as cracked grout, so noggins and fixing centres matter more than adhesive brand.

Your questions answered

Can I tile over existing tiles?

Sometimes, if they are sound and flat, but it adds thickness and risks inheriting an old failure.

Is plasterboard acceptable in a shower?

Only with a proper tanking system over it; unprotected board in a shower will eventually fail.
